Have you ever had Ugli fruit?

Neither have we! They were having a fruit sale at the store and since we are old and married, we go to the grocery store for our Saturday night activity. We bought pummello, cara cara oranges, blood oranges, minneola and ugli fruit. This is the ugli fruit. How weird!

Jordan is a little unsure of the Ugli.... It had a really mild citrus flavor, sort of like a grapefruit texture, but super thick skin. We werent fans of the ugli!

I am about to try the blood orange. These werent so bad. Like a pomegranate orange mix.
They have a really deep red almost maroon color with a hint of orange. We also tried a pummello. It was my favorite! We still have cara cara oranges and minneola to try.
